FINANCE REVIEW SUMMARY — Warranty Cost Overrun
For: Finance Team

So, the warranty reserve for the Tolverin appliance line blew past plan by 23% this quarter. Main culprit: the hinge assembly issue on units shipped from the Darnfield plant — claims are running about double our model. Supplier chargebacks should claw back maybe a third; the rest hits margin. We've tightened the reserve assumptions going forward and flagged the line for a design review. More detail at next month's close. One confidential note on business plans follows below.

internal memo for yahaf-hawif: The finance team signed off on a budget of $59.9 million for Project Rusax.

### Step 4: Tune GC in the Matchwright Service

After upgrading the runtime, switch Matchwright to the low-pause collector; the old defaults caused 400ms stalls during peak matching. Set the heap ceiling to 6 GB and verify pause times stay under 20ms in the soak test. The soak harness logs results to the database reachable with the following string.

primary connection of tawif-yajeg = postgresql://rusiel_svc:G879q9cx6GsSvj@db-dd9f.norvagrid.internal:5432/casath

Q3 gross margin at Orvella Goods: 41.2%, down 180bps quarter-on-quarter. Drivers: freight inflation on the Castrel route, discounting in the mid-tier range, and an unfavourable mix shift toward the Larkspur line. Offsetting: packaging cost savings landed ahead of schedule. Actions: repricing review on mid-tier SKUs due in two weeks; freight contract renegotiation underway; mix targets reset for Q4. No change to full-year guidance yet. The note below outlines the confidential element of the recovery plan.

board note of bagef-bahaf: Headcount on the Oliael team goes from 3 to 120 by the end of October. Gross margin on Oliael came in at 10 percent against a plan of 15 percent.

Subject: SDK parity ownership change

Welcome aboard. Quick note: responsibility for feature parity between the Larkspur Android SDK and the Larkspur iOS SDK has moved off my plate as of this sprint. Parity gaps are tracked in the Driftboard backlog under the "parity" tag. Don't merge anything that adds a capability to one SDK without filing a matching ticket for the other. For approvals, escalations, or parity questions, contact the new owner listed below.

named custodian: Quenael Briax